在现代软件开发中,数据库开发环境的选择对于项目的成功至关重要,Anzhuo数据库作为一款新兴的数据库管理系统,凭借其高性能、高可靠性和易用性,逐渐受到开发者和企业的青睐,本文将详细介绍Anzhuo数据库的开发环境,帮助开发者更好地理解和使用这款优秀的数据库系统。
一、Anzhuo数据库简介
Anzhuo数据库是一款分布式关系型数据库管理系统,支持SQL标准,具备高可扩展性和高可用性,它采用分布式架构,能够在多个节点上存储数据,并通过分布式计算提高查询性能,Anzhuo数据库适用于大规模数据处理场景,如金融、电信、互联网等行业。
二、Anzhuo数据库开发环境搭建
1. 系统要求
要搭建Anzhuo数据库开发环境,首先需要满足以下系统要求:
组件 | 最低要求 |
CPU | 4核 |
内存 | 8GB |
磁盘空间 | 500GB |
操作系统 | Ubuntu 20.04 LTS, CentOS 7/8 |
Java版本 | JDK 11+ |
Maven版本 | 3.6+ |
Git版本 | 2.20+ |
2. 安装步骤
步骤1:安装Java开发工具包(JDK)
Anzhuo数据库是基于Java开发的,因此首先需要安装JDK,可以使用以下命令安装OpenJDK:
sudo apt-get update sudo apt-get install openjdk-11-jdk -y
步骤2:安装Maven
Maven是一个项目管理和构建工具,用于管理项目的依赖关系和构建过程,可以使用以下命令安装Maven:
sudo apt-get install maven -y
步骤3:下载Anzhuo数据库源码
从Anzhuo数据库的官方网站或GitHub仓库下载最新的源码包,可以使用Git命令克隆仓库:
git clone https://github.com/anzhuo/anzhuo.git cd anzhuo
步骤4:编译和打包
进入项目根目录后,使用Maven进行编译和打包:
mvn clean package -DskipTests
步骤5:配置环境变量
为了方便运行Anzhuo数据库,可以将编译生成的可执行文件路径添加到系统的环境变量中:
export PATH=$PATH:/path/to/anzhuo/target/bin
步骤6:启动数据库服务
使用以下命令启动Anzhuo数据库服务:
anzhuo-server start
三、Anzhuo数据库开发环境配置
1. 配置文件
Anzhuo数据库的配置文件通常位于conf
目录下,主要配置文件包括anzhuo.properties
和logback.xml
,可以根据实际需求修改这些配置文件,以适应不同的开发和生产环境。
2. 数据库连接
在Java项目中,可以通过JDBC连接到Anzhuo数据库,以下是一个简单的示例代码:
import java.sql.Connection; import java.sql.DriverManager; import java.sql.ResultSet; import java.sql.Statement; public class AnzhuoTest { public static void main(String[] args) { try { // 加载驱动程序 Class.forName("com.anzhuo.jdbc.Driver"); // 建立连接 Connection conn = DriverManager.getConnection("jdbc:anzhuo://localhost:8080/mydb", "username", "password"); // 创建语句对象 Statement stmt = conn.createStatement(); // 执行查询 ResultSet rs = stmt.executeQuery("SELECT * FROM mytable"); // 处理结果集 while (rs.next()) { System.out.println(rs.getString("column1")); } // 关闭连接 rs.close(); stmt.close(); conn.close(); } catch (Exception e) { e.printStackTrace(); } } }
3. 数据库管理工具
为了方便管理和操作Anzhuo数据库,可以使用一些图形化的数据库管理工具,如DBeaver、DataGrip等,这些工具提供了直观的用户界面,可以方便地执行SQL查询、管理数据库对象和查看日志信息。
四、常见问题解答(FAQs)
问题1:如何在Anzhuo数据库中创建表?
在Anzhuo数据库中创建表与在其他关系型数据库中类似,可以使用SQL语句进行操作,以下是一个创建表的示例:
CREATE TABLE mytable ( id INT PRIMARY KEY, name VARCHAR(50), age INT, address VARCHAR(100) );
问题2:如何优化Anzhuo数据库的性能?
优化Anzhuo数据库性能可以从以下几个方面入手:
索引优化:为常用查询字段创建索引,提高查询速度。
分区表:对于大表,可以使用分区表技术,将数据分散到多个节点上,提高查询和写入性能。
缓存机制:利用缓存机制,减少频繁的数据库访问,提高系统响应速度。
参数调优:根据具体业务场景,调整数据库的配置参数,如缓存大小、连接数等。
小编有话说
通过本文的介绍,相信大家对Anzhuo数据库的开发环境有了更深入的了解,在实际开发过程中,合理配置和优化数据库环境,可以显著提高系统的性能和稳定性,希望本文能够帮助大家更好地使用Anzhuo数据库,打造高效、可靠的应用系统,如果在使用过程中遇到任何问题,欢迎在评论区留言讨论,我们将尽力为大家解答。
以上就是关于“anzhuo数据库开发环境”的问题,朋友们可以点击主页了解更多内容,希望可以够帮助大家!
原创文章,作者:K-seo,如若转载,请注明出处:https://www.kdun.cn/ask/785619.html